Dallas right now picks 7th

Round 1
1. Titans Laremy Tunsil T Ole Miss
2. Chargers Miles Jack LB UCLA
3. Browns Joey Bosa OLB Ohio State
4. Ravens Jalen Ramsey S Florida State
5. Lions Vernon Hargreaves CB Florida
6. Niners Paxton Lynch QB Memphis
7. Dallas Trades with STL Dallas gets RD1 RD3 RD5 picks
7. Rams Jared Goff QB Cal
8. Jaguars Robert Nkemdiche DT Ole Miss
9. Saints Jaylen Smith LB ND
10. Bears Ronnie Staley T ND
11. Cowboys Ezekiel Elliot RB Ohio State
Dallas misses a RB who can create and keep a defense honest. Something they dont have now since they lost Murray. Elliot gives them that guy who can carry the load when the passing game has stalled. We saw last yr when Dallas needed a kick start they gave the ball to Murray and let the big men in front lead the way. Elliot allows Dallas to get that hammer back.

Round 2
Jeremy Cash S Duke
Guy is going to climb and I think if they want him they're probably going to have to take him here. He can play all over the field. And make plays where ever they put him. He loves to hit and blitz too. Would give the Cowboys that S combo that marinelli wants.Jones being the deep safety and Cash being the one to play the run but can go back and play that 2 deep zone.

Round 3
Desmond King CB Iowa
Makes plays on the ball. Not tall but puts himself in position to just make plays.

Round 3(STL)
Adolph Washington DT Ohio State
Certainly he's going to drop some after his arrest. But if the team interviews him and he checks out, Dallas has shown they will take a chance(Gregory). Would be a steal at this point.

Round 4
Braxton Miller WR Ohio State
Guy who you can just put all over the field and he'll make a play. Type of player Jerry usually drools over.

Round 5
Kevin Hogan QB Stanford
Smart QB who has need to develop, but he'd have time behind Romo.

Round 5(STL)
Taveze Calhoun CB Miss State
Physical CB who would make a nice dime CB. aggressive and actually likes to tackle.Could develop into a starter.
